
你有没有发现,很多公司一说要“实时数仓”,现场气氛立刻变得凝重?有人满腔热血,想用数据驱动一切决策;也有人经历过“数据延迟、报表失灵、业务落地难”的阵痛——最后,数仓项目成了一本“难念的经”。其实,实时数仓不是玄学,但它确实比传统数仓复杂得多。如果你正面临数据分析提速、业务敏捷响应、数据治理难题,这篇文章绝对值得你花时间读下去。这里,我们不仅聊清楚“实时数仓到底是什么”,还会结合头部行业的落地实践,帮你厘清:哪些场景真正适合实时数仓?如何架构?如何避坑?又该如何结合主流工具(比如帆软)实现端到端提效?
下面是本文将深入探讨的四大核心要点:
- 1. 🚀实时数仓的本质与进化:从OLAP到实时分析
- 2. 🏗️实时数仓的技术架构全解:核心组件与关键流程
- 3. 💡真实落地场景分析:行业案例与最佳实践
- 4. 🛠️实时数仓落地常见挑战与解决方案
如果你正为企业数字化转型发愁,或正考虑将实时数仓引入数据分析体系,这篇内容会帮你少走弯路。话不多说,我们直接进入正题。
🚀一、实时数仓的本质与进化:从OLAP到实时分析
1.1 现实业务为什么需要实时数仓?
“数据分析早一分钟,业务决策快一小时。” 这是许多行业的真实写照。传统的数仓(数据仓库,Data Warehouse)以天为单位做批量处理,非常适合财务月报、年度分析这类长周期需求。但到了今天,互联网、零售、制造、医疗这些行业,业务变化已经“以秒计”,批处理数仓明显跟不上节奏。
举个例子:某大型电商在618大促期间,需要实时监控每分钟的订单量、库存变化和异常订单。传统数仓ETL流程慢,数据延迟1小时,分析出来时促销高峰早就过去了。类似地,智慧交通要根据实时路况调整信号灯策略,金融风控要秒级识别异常交易……这些场景都倒逼“实时数仓”成为刚需。
- 强时效性业务:如风控预警、实时推荐、智能调度
- 高并发数据接入:秒级/毫秒级数据写入和处理
- 自助分析驱动:业务团队随时拉取最新数据,快速响应
因此,实时数仓的最大价值,就是让数据“从库里出来”,变成业务的实时大脑。
1.2 实时数仓与传统数仓的区别究竟在哪里?
很多人把“实时数仓”理解成“把数据处理速度提升”。其实,这只是表象。实时数仓本质上是数据生产、加工、消费全流程的架构升级。与传统数仓相比,实时数仓有几个关键不同点:
- 数据流动方式:传统数仓以批处理为主,实时数仓以流处理为核心
- 数据一致性:传统数仓强调强一致,实时数仓更多采用最终一致性策略
- 架构复杂度:实时数仓需要数据采集、流式计算、时序存储等多层协作
- 业务响应速度:分钟级、秒级,甚至亚秒级的数据可用性
比如,传统数仓每天晚上1点全量同步数据,第二天业务团队才能用最新数据。但在实时数仓体系下,数据一产生就被采集、加工、入库,几乎随时可以分析和展示,极大提升了数据驱动业务的效率和体验。
1.3 实时数仓的核心价值是什么?
实时数仓的核心价值,就是数据驱动业务的“即时性”和“灵活性”。
- 业务决策提速:让决策者以“数据事实”为依据,秒级响应市场变化
- 异常预警与智能调度:实时发现问题,自动化触发应急策略,减少损失
- 精细化运营:根据实时数据调整价格、库存、资源分配,提升收益
- 客户体验升级:基于用户行为实时推荐、个性化服务,增强粘性
以帆软为例,很多客户通过其FineReport、FineBI、FineDataLink等产品,打通了数据从采集、治理到分析的全链路,实现了从“数据汇聚”到“业务闭环”的转型。结果很直观:部分制造企业的生产异常响应从30分钟缩短到3分钟;零售企业的促销转化率提升了15%。这正是实时数仓赋能业务的直接体现。
🏗️二、实时数仓的技术架构全解:核心组件与关键流程
2.1 实时数仓的整体技术架构长什么样?
实时数仓的架构,简单来说就是“数据流动的高速公路”——从源头到终端,每个环节都要又快又稳。一般来说,实时数仓分为四大层级:
- 数据采集层:负责将线上业务系统(如数据库、消息队列、IoT设备等)的数据实时捕获并推送到下游。
- 数据处理层:主要是流式计算(如Flink、Spark Streaming等),实现数据的清洗、聚合、加工等实时处理。
- 数据存储层:采用高并发、低延迟的数据库(如ClickHouse、Doris、HBase等)实现数据快速写入与查询。
- 数据服务层:对外提供API、报表、可视化、智能分析等服务,实现数据价值的最大化释放。
比如,某消费品牌通过帆软FineDataLink实时采集电商平台数据,利用Flink做流式计算,结果存入ClickHouse,最后通过FineReport一键生成实时经营分析报表。全流程延迟控制在2秒以内,业务部门随时掌握最新动态。这种“端到端”链路,就是实时数仓架构的典型案例。
2.2 关键技术组件详解及主流方案选型
实时数仓要落地,核心技术选型至关重要。下面,我们拆解几个关键组件,结合实际案例说明:
- 1. 实时数据采集:
- 常用组件:Kafka、Canal、DataX、Flink CDC等
- 应用场景:如实时采集订单、库存、用户行为日志等。
- 案例说明:某零售企业用Flink CDC监控MySQL变更,实时同步到数仓。数据延迟从10分钟缩短到1分钟,库存管理更精准。
- 2. 流式计算引擎:
- 常用组件:Flink(高吞吐、低延迟)、Spark Streaming、Storm
- 应用场景:实时清洗、聚合、ETL、业务规则处理。
- 案例说明:制造企业用Flink流式统计生产线异常,自动触发预警,降低了30%的故障停机时间。
- 3. 实时存储引擎:
- 常用组件:ClickHouse(列式存储、极快查询)、Doris、HBase
- 应用场景:大数据量、高并发OLAP分析。
- 案例说明:互联网企业用ClickHouse支撑亿级日志数据分析,报表查询从5分钟缩短到3秒。
- 4. 可视化与数据服务:
- 常用组件:FineReport、FineBI、Tableau、PowerBI等
- 应用场景:多维分析、实时监控看板、自动化报表分发。
- 案例说明:帆软客户通过FineBI自助拖拽分析,业务人员无需写SQL即可获取最新销售数据,分析效率提升80%。
技术选型没有“银弹”,要结合实际业务场景、数据规模、团队能力综合考量。帆软等厂商通过一站式平台,降低了实时数仓的落地门槛,助力各行业企业快速构建数据驱动能力。
2.3 实时数仓的数据流转与治理要点
实时数仓不仅仅是“数据快”,更重要的是“数据准”和“数据可管控”。在实际落地过程中,企业需要关注以下几个治理核心:
- 数据质量保障:实时数仓强调“过程监控”,要及时发现数据异常、丢失、重复等问题。比如,利用FineDataLink的数据质量模块,自动监控数据流转全程,异常自动告警。
- 元数据管理:实时流转数据容易“漂移”,需做好全链路血缘追踪,确保数据用得明白、查得清楚。
- 权限与安全:实时数据极具敏感性,要按业务角色分级授权,防止数据泄露。帆软平台支持细粒度权限配置,满足金融、医疗等高安全行业需求。
- 多源异构整合:面对多类型源数据(结构化、半结构化、非结构化),需支持灵活的数据集成与模型设计。
只有做好数据治理,实时数仓才能真正“赋能业务”,而不是“制造新混乱”。
💡三、真实落地场景分析:行业案例与最佳实践
3.1 消费零售业:秒级洞察用户,精准营销提效
消费零售行业数据量巨大、业务变化极快。以某全国性连锁品牌为例,实时数仓的应用场景包括:实时订单监控、会员行为分析、门店销量排行、库存预警等。
- 实时订单监控:总部实时掌握各门店销售情况。通过帆软FineReport,业务员可在大屏上看到全网订单流入、热销品类排行、单品缺货预警等数据,决策效率大幅提升。
- 个性化营销:基于实时会员打卡、消费行为,自动生成推送策略。促销转化率提升10%-18%。
- 库存动态预警:通过流式分析,自动检测滞销与爆款商品,及时调整采购和货架陈列。
实时数仓让零售企业真正实现“以用户为中心”的精细化运营。比如,帆软的行业解决方案支持自助数据分析、可视化展示、自动生成经营日报,助力品牌从数据洞察到决策闭环。实际反馈显示,门店响应速度提升30%,运营成本下降15%。
3.2 制造行业:智能工厂的“数字大脑”
制造业的实时数仓应用场景同样丰富。以某智能工厂为例,实时采集生产线传感器数据、设备状态、工单流转等信息,通过流式计算实现:
- 生产异常秒级预警:异常停机、产量异常、质量波动立刻推送到管理层,大幅降低设备损失。
- 动态产线调度:根据实时订单与产能,智能分配工单,提高生产柔性。
- 可追溯生产过程:通过FineReport可视化,管理层实时回溯每一批次的原材料、设备、人员、工时等关键环节。
数据驱动的智能工厂,生产效率提升10%-25%,故障停机时长下降20%-40%。这些数字背后,是实时数仓架构的支撑和数据治理能力的落地。帆软的平台产品将数据采集、治理、分析、可视化全流程打通,帮助制造业客户形成“智能决策中枢”。
3.3 交通、医疗、烟草等行业的特色应用
智慧交通:实时采集路网、信号灯、车辆流量、事故报警等数据,支撑信号灯动态调度、事故快速响应、路况预测等智能决策。某地级市交通局通过帆软解决方案,事故响应时间缩短40%,拥堵指数降低15%。
医疗行业:医院通过实时采集挂号、候诊、药品库存、设备使用率等数据,优化资源调度和服务流程。帆软客户反馈,患者平均候诊时间缩短20%,药品缺货率下降30%。
烟草行业:烟叶采购、生产、仓储、物流全流程实时监控,助力精确追溯与合规监管。通过FineReport自定义报表,管理者可一键查看各环节运营指标,数据时效性从日级提升到分钟级。
这些行业案例证明,实时数仓已成为数字化转型的“标配”。选择合适的平台和架构,是迈向业务智能化的关键一步。如果你正考虑行业数字化转型,推荐了解帆软的一站式数据集成、分析与可视化平台,覆盖从数据采集、治理到应用的全链路需求。[海量分析方案立即获取]
🛠️四、实时数仓落地常见挑战与解决方案
4.1 业务落地常见“坑点”分析
“数仓快,业务难用”,这是很多项目的真实困扰。实时数仓落地过程中,企业常遇到以下几个典型“坑”:
- 技术选型不当:只关注“快”,忽略了数据一致性、安全性、可维护性,导致后期数据混乱。
- 数据质量失控:实时流转下,错误、重复、丢失难以及时发现,影响分析结果可靠性。
- 业务与IT割裂:业务部门需求多变,IT团队难以快速适配,导致数据服务不能“用起来”。
- 治理能力薄弱:实时数据量大、类型多,缺少元数据管理、权限管控,安全与合规风险高。
很多企业上线实时数仓后,发现“能跑起来,但业务不会用”,或者“数据太杂不敢用”,本质上就是架构和治理没有闭环。
4.2 解决之道:架构设计、数据治理与业务协同三管齐下
要让实时数仓真正落地,必须“架构设计、数据治理、业务协同”三位一体。
- 1. 架构弹性设计:结合业务需求合理规划实时、准实时、离线多层架构。不是所有数据都要实时,比如财务结算、年度分析更适合离线,业务看板、异常预警则必须实时。
- 2. 数据治理全流程:从数据采集、处理、存
本文相关FAQs
🧐 实时数仓到底是什么?企业数字化转型时为什么总听到这个词?
最近老板老是说要推进实时数仓建设,搞数字化转型。但我看网上说法特别多,有的说就是数据仓库升级,有的说是实时分析平台。有没有大佬能通俗点讲讲啥是实时数仓,企业为啥这么重视这个东西?到底解决了什么实际问题?
你好,我理解你的困惑。其实“实时数仓”这个词最近很火,主要是因为企业越来越需要快速反应市场变化。传统的数据仓库(数仓)通常是“批量处理”,比如每天凌晨跑一次数据,白天用的都是昨天的信息。而实时数仓,就是把这个过程加速:数据一到,就立刻能分析、查询、决策。
核心价值:- 让业务人员随时掌握最新数据,比如销售额、库存、客户行为。
- 遇到异常(比如订单异常激增、物流延迟),第一时间能看到、能应对。
- 推动业务自动化,像实时推荐、风险监控、智能营销都离不开实时数仓。
企业重视它,主要是因为信息滞后太容易出事,比如电商大促、金融风控、制造现场,延迟一分钟可能就是几十万损失。
通俗点说,实时数仓就是让数据“像流水一样”随时可用,帮企业从被动变主动。它不是单纯的数据仓库升级,而是业务链条的加速器。你可以把它理解成企业大脑实时在线,随时处理外部刺激。现在数字化转型,实时数仓已经是“标配”了,谁做得快、做得好,谁就能赢得市场机会。🔍 搭建实时数仓有哪些核心技术和流程?企业实际落地会遇到哪些坑?
我们公司最近准备搭建实时数仓,技术选型一堆,流程也复杂。有没有大佬能详细讲讲实时数仓的核心技术和建设流程?落地过程中有哪些容易踩坑的地方?怕后期维护成本爆炸啊。
你好,这个问题非常实际。我自己踩过不少坑,分享一些经验。
核心技术:- 数据采集与接入:实时数仓要能“秒级”接入业务数据,常用Kafka、Flink这类流处理框架。
- 数据处理与ETL:和传统数仓不同,实时ETL需要边采边清洗,Flink、Spark Streaming最常用。
- 数据存储:OLAP型存储如ClickHouse、Doris,或者云上的BigQuery,适合高并发、低延迟分析。
- 可视化与分析:像帆软、Tableau这样的平台能接入实时数据,做图表、报表、自动预警。
建设流程:
1. 明确业务场景和需求(比如实时库存、交易监控)。
2. 设计数据流向和架构(数据源、流处理、存储、分析)。
3. 技术选型、搭建测试环境,先跑通核心场景。
4. 优化性能、数据质量,逐步扩展业务。
常见坑:
– 数据延迟、丢失。流处理出错时很难追溯,建议加监控、日志溯源。 – 业务和技术脱节。需求变动导致架构频繁调整,最好先做小范围试点。 – 数据一致性和质量。实时处理很容易脏数据,ETL逻辑要严谨。 – 维护成本高。流处理和存储都需要专业运维,建议用成熟平台如帆软等,降低运维难度。
总之,实时数仓不是一蹴而就,建议先聚焦关键场景,逐步优化,避免一上来就“大而全”,后期维护确实容易爆炸。⚡️ 实时数仓和传统数仓到底有啥区别?业务场景上怎么选?
搞数仓好多年了,老板突然说要“实时”,让我把老数仓升级。其实传统数仓也能满足大多数分析需求,实时数仓除了速度快,还有哪些业务场景优势?什么情况下必须用实时数仓?
你好,老数仓见多识广的经验真宝贵!其实“实时”和“传统”数仓最关键的区别就是数据处理和分析的时间维度。传统数仓一般是T+1(昨天数据今天用),适合做趋势分析、历史报告、年度规划。实时数仓是“数据一到,立马可用”,适合业务需要秒级响应的场景。
具体场景举几个例子:- 实时监控:像金融风控、订单异常、生产线故障,必须秒级发现,传统数仓根本来不及。
- 实时推荐:电商、内容平台、广告投放,用户行为一变就要动态推荐。
- 自动预警:库存告警、流量异常、客户投诉,实时数仓能自动触发处理流程。
- 业务自动化:比如智能调度、动态定价,背后都需要实时数据支撑。
选型建议:
– 如果业务只是做月度、季度分析,传统数仓就够了。 – 如果越来越多场景需要“秒级反应”,比如线上业务、实时监控,就必须上实时数仓。 – 很多企业现在是“两套体系”并行,历史分析用传统数仓,实时业务用实时数仓。
升级建议:别全盘替换,先选几个实时场景试点,验证价值再扩展。升级过程技术挑战不少,建议优先用成熟工具,帆软的数据集成、分析和可视化解决方案在行业落地很广,有大量案例可以参考,海量解决方案在线下载,适合初次落地、快速试点。🔓 实时数仓落地后怎么保障数据安全、质量和可维护性?有哪些最佳实践?
我们数仓上线后,老板要求数据必须实时、准确、安全,还要便于后期维护。有没有大佬能分享一下实际落地后怎么保障数据安全和质量?维护方面有哪些坑,怎么规避?
你好,这个问题很关键,很多项目上线后才发现“数据安全、质量、维护”才是最难搞的。我的经验主要分三块:
1. 数据安全保障:- 权限细分:不同岗位只看自己业务的数据,敏感数据加密存储。
- 审计日志:所有操作、查询都有溯源,出问题能追查。
- 多层防护:外部接入、内部流转都要加密传输,防止数据泄露。
2. 数据质量控制:
- 实时校验:每条数据流入都自动校验格式、完整性、业务规则。
- 异常预警:数据异常及时推送,自动处理或人工介入。
- 多源比对:关键业务数据多渠道采集,互相校验。
3. 可维护性提升:
- 自动化运维:流处理、存储、分析平台都要有自动监控、自动恢复。
- 配置化管理:所有数据流、ETL逻辑用配置文件管理,方便调整。
- 文档和培训:上线前后都要有详细文档和操作流程,减少运维压力。
最佳实践分享:
– 别贪“大而全”,先做关键场景,保证简单可控。 – 用成熟平台,比如帆软的数据集成、分析和可视化工具,安全、质量、运维都有标准方案,能大大减轻后期压力。 – 多做小步快跑,随时复盘和优化。
如果你想看行业落地案例和详细方案,推荐帆软官方的行业解决方案库,海量解决方案在线下载,涵盖制造、零售、金融、医疗等各类场景,建议下载看看,有很多实操细节可以借鉴。希望对你有帮助!本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



